What Should You Look for in a Hyatt Prive Travel Advisor? Not all advisors offering Prive bookings provide the same level of service, and the difference often shows up in how they handle special requests, room category negotiations, or issues that arise mid-stay. A strong advisor will confirm the specific benefits in writing before the trip, including the property credit amount and what it can be applied toward, rather than leaving the guest to discover the details at check-in. They will also flag whether a hotel is currently honoring full Prive benefits, since some properties temporarily reduce amenities during peak occupancy periods or major events in the destination.

How Do You Actually Book Through Hyatt Prive? Booking a Hyatt Prive stay requires going through a Hyatt Prive travel agent rather than the hotel's own website, since the general public booking engine does not display these enhanced rates or automatically attach the associated perks. The process begins with identifying an advisor who holds accreditation within the Prive network, which is typically part of a larger luxury consortia such as Virtuoso, Signature Travel Network, or a similar invitation-only agency group. These advisors have direct relationships with Hyatt's luxury division and access to a private rate and amenity structure that individual consumers cannot request on their own.

Once connected with a qualified advisor, the actual booking mechanics are straightforward: you provide your travel dates, preferred property, and room type preferences, and the advisor submits the reservation with the Prive designation attached. There is no membership fee charged to you as the traveler, and the room rate is typically identical to or sometimes lower than what you would find booking directly, since advisors often have access to negotiated rates unavailable to the public. The advisor also serves as your point of contact if anything goes wrong during the stay, which adds a layer of support that a standard online booking simply does not provide.
